    Default Need advice on dealing with Telus for a new phone

    Here is the deal:

    -I've been with Telus for around 2 years
    -My monthly bill is around $200
    -I have no contract with them as mine ended last year

    My phone is slowly starting to die on me and I'm looking at getting one of their new phones (I'm interested in the new whizzy Razr). I'll either do a "no contract" or a 1 year contract....but not really interested in a 2 or 3 year contract.

    Will Telus give me a break on the prices of their phones on the website for a customer who spends $200 month and has been with them for a couple of years?

    I'm also considering going to Rogers...so would they be more inclined to give a deal if I used that "idle threat"of jumping to a competitor?

    Any input of advice would be appreciated.

    CAll *611 and ask to speak to the Loyalty department

    Tell them that Bell/Rogers....are offering you X to come to them

    Well i was on a 3 year contract, and at 2 years my V60 started to die in less than a day and i had replaced the anteni like 4 times. I called telus complained about the phone said that i would like to stay with them and ask what they could do for me and that i wanted a new phone for free. They gave me enough money that i only had to pay and extra 40$ for and LG 6190 on a 3 year contract. I only rack up a bill between 60-80$ a month too. Just choose your words wisely keep calling to you get some super nice and willing to hook it up! good luck
